1. Product Overview

3A99165G04 is single-width Eurocard plug-in servo power amplifier optimized on the basis of G03 hardware design, fully pin-to-pin compatible with all former G-series versions for direct field replacement without cabinet rewiring. It receives ±10V analog/PWM valve command signals from 3A99164G50 speed controller card, converts control signal into constant drive current for EH servo solenoid coil, meanwhile collects multi-channel LVDT valve position feedback to complete closed-loop position regulation of turbine main stop valves and governing valves.
Compared with G03 version, G04 optimizes internal power drive circuit, EMC filter network and overheat protection design, greatly improving anti-interference capacity under severe high-frequency electromagnetic environment inside power plant control cabinet and reducing valve hunting/position drift failure rate.

2. Electrical Specifications

  • Backplane power supply: +5VDC, ±12VDC supplied by 3A99132 series PCPS rack power module

  • Control input: ±10VDC analog signal / PWM modulated signal from upper master card

  • Rated output current: adjustable constant current 0~±40mA for EH servo magnet coil driving

  • Feedback channel: multi-group AC small-signal input port for LVDT displacement transducer connection

  • Onboard configuration: independent channel short-circuit fuse, upgraded surge absorption component, precision adjustable gain potentiometer for on-site closed-loop parameter calibration, full-stage RC anti-noise filter circuit

3. Environmental & Mechanical Parameters

  • Operating ambient temp inside cabinet: -10℃ ~ +65℃; storage temperature: -40℃ ~ +85℃

  • Working humidity: 5%~95% RH non-condensing; whole PCB coated with three-proof conformal paint

  • Compliance standard: IEC61000 EMC anti-electromagnetic interference specification for power industry

  • Dimension: standard Ovation single slot card size same as G01~G03, metal shielding frame design

4. Panel Indication & Maintenance Feature

Front panel equipped with independent LED indicators for power status, input signal fault, output overload, LVDT feedback abnormality respectively; reserved test terminals for multimeter detection and loop debugging during field maintenance. Cold-swap supported under rack standby condition without full power cut, widely configured redundant dual-card on critical turbine governing loop for uninterrupted control.

5. Supply & Common Fault Description

Original OEM production discontinued; available products include fully bench-tested refurbished modules and surplus original spare parts with standard 12-month warranty.
  • No output: mostly caused by blown channel fuse or damaged rear-stage drive chip

  • Valve oscillating/hunting: filter capacitor degradation or gain potentiometer parameter drift

  • Slow valve position drifting: aging LVDT signal pre-amplifier circuit or poor PCB gold finger contact
